5, 15, 65, 315, ?

A

1556

B

1565

C

1665

D

1656

Text Solution

AI Generated Solution

The correct Answer is:
To find the missing number in the series: 5, 15, 65, 315, ?, we can follow these steps: ### Step 1: Identify the pattern We start with the first number, which is 5. We need to find a consistent operation that transforms each number into the next. ### Step 2: Analyze the transitions - From 5 to 15: - We can multiply 5 by 5 and then subtract 10: \[ 5 \times 5 - 10 = 25 - 10 = 15 \] - From 15 to 65: - Similarly, we multiply 15 by 5 and then subtract 10: \[ 15 \times 5 - 10 = 75 - 10 = 65 \] - From 65 to 315: - Again, we multiply 65 by 5 and then subtract 10: \[ 65 \times 5 - 10 = 325 - 10 = 315 \] ### Step 3: Apply the pattern to find the next number Now, we can use the same operation to find the next number after 315: \[ 315 \times 5 - 10 \] Calculating this gives: \[ 315 \times 5 = 1575 \] Now subtracting 10: \[ 1575 - 10 = 1565 \] ### Conclusion Thus, the missing number in the series is **1565**. ---
